;To make sure the letter is up to the industry standards, here are a few steps you may follow for writing a professional work experience letter: 1. Use the organisation letterhead. As the work experience letter is a professional document, you should always write it on the company letterhead. ;An experience letter is a document written by an employer that confirms and summarizes an employee’s work experience. It includes details such as job title, responsibilities, duration of employment, and sometimes even performance evaluations.

If you ever have to write an experience letter, or want to know what's included in your own, follow these steps: 1. Use company letterhead. When writing a letter of experience for a current or previous employee, it may be helpful to write it using the company letterhead. A work experience letter is something you attach on your application for work experience to let a company know you re interested in finding a placement with them It s similar to a cover letter although it will tend to focus more on your skills and education rather than your previous experience although it is possible to find work
